Best-fit buyer
This page is for a public or buyer-owned YouTube video with a claimed section, monetization concern, or pre-upload music-risk check. It does not dispute the claim or clear the original song. It creates a replacement direction that does not copy the claimed track.
Capture the affected section, hook point, voiceover moments, sponsor reads, and end-card timing.
Describe the pacing job the old music did without imitating melody, lyrics, artist sound, or production identity.
Delivery includes source/tool note, source-rights assumptions, excluded requests, and channel context.
The packet helps create a replacement order trail. It is not legal advice, a Content ID dispute, or a promise of claim removal.
Why this niche
YouTube documents how Content ID works, gives creators tools to remove claimed content, and provides Audio Library music. The sellable gap is a custom replacement packet for a specific edit: timestamps, channel use, source-rights intake, and a new non-copying music direction before payment.
